The Contemporary Art World

 

ARTS1-CE9041 / $430
SPRING 2012
Continuing Education: Arts Programs

New York City's art season ushers in the most exciting paintings, sculpture, photography, and installation work in the contemporary art world. Visit the most important exhibits and develop an understanding of the aesthetics of modern art. Exhibitions are selected by the instructor from those announced by museums and galleries. Meetings are devoted to major exhibitions in leading art museums or to shows in the more prominent and lesser-known art galleries in Chelsea, SoHo, and the galleries of 57th Street.

Tuition does not include museum fees. No grades issued.
